- SaPradiMay 12, 2025 · 2 months agoSure! One recommended intrinsic value calculator for evaluating cryptocurrencies is the NVT Ratio. It calculates the network value to transaction ratio, which helps determine whether a cryptocurrency is overvalued or undervalued. The formula is simple: divide the market cap by the daily transaction volume. A high NVT Ratio suggests that the cryptocurrency may be overvalued, while a low ratio indicates potential undervaluation. Keep in mind that the NVT Ratio is just one tool among many, and it's important to consider other factors as well when evaluating digital assets.
